7. A copy of the team entries are attached. Some of the swimmer's
times could not be found in the USA Swimming SWIMS database and were
not used for entry times. Instead, the best time found in the SWIMS
database was used according to the meet entry rules. Some swimmers
were added into additional events according to the meet entry rules
which allows each LSC to enter up to 2 swimmers in each event
regardless of qualifying times. The criteria used to add swimmers
into events included swimmer speed (priority for swimmers who were
close to the qualifying time), swimmer total number of events and
team need. I was not able to add swimmers into every event in which
we are short on entries.
